Return to Cookie Mountain , the TV on the Radio album released before this year's Dear Science , had jams of such epic proportions that most of the newer tracks didn't really have a fighting chance. However, the standout "Golden Age" (Of Montreal mixed into George Michael with a sprig of Prince—am I wrong?) most accurately distills what’s enjoyable about TVOTR, with dance party-ready beats and lyrics that read as smart as they sound. In their by-now familiar fashion, TV on the Radio take new-yet-familiar sounds, smack them upside the face, then invite a couple beats over. Complete awesomeness [...]

TV On The Radio - Dear Science TV on the Radio Dear Science (09.2008, DGC/Interscope) Verdict = Better than Return to Cookie Mountain TV on the Radio has emerged as one of the most distinctive voices on the modern indie music landscape (though they’re not technically indie anymore) and as such will always be walking a thin line in regards to follow up albums with fans ready to yell “sell out” at a moments notice. Fortunately, Dear Science , doesn’t fall into to that Modest Mousian trap, but there are still going to be a lot of [...]

TV on the Radio playing outside, Dear Science out Tuesday TV on the Radio are playing an outside performance for Letterman today, Monday September 22nd. People that want to watch can show up at 53rd and Broadway - taping is 7-8 and they play "Dancing Choose" around 7:45. Real TVOTR show dates HERE . Their new album Dear Science is out Tuesday.
